Measure inside, where the mixture sits.
Use the dimensions of the inside base, not the complete pan including rims and handles. Record the depth too. Rounded corners, tapered walls and decorative shapes complicate the comparison; the calculator models a flat rectangle or a circle. For anything more elaborate, use the manufacturer’s stated capacity and a recipe developed for that pan.
A round pan’s base area is π times its radius squared. A rectangular base is length times width. A 20 cm square has an area of 400 cm²; a 24 cm circle has an area of about 452.4 cm². The round base is about 1.131 times as large.
Decide whether the fill depth should stay similar.
If the goal is a similar depth in pans of compatible shape and construction, the area ratio offers a starting point for ingredient scaling. It is not a universal safe-fill rule. A batter or dough may expand, and the recipe may depend on a specific depth or support from the walls.
Our tool keeps original and replacement measurements separate and accepts centimetres or inches for either. It converts before comparing, so a measurement entered in inches is not accidentally treated as centimetres. The result is a multiplier, not a recommended number of minutes.
Review what the calculation leaves out.
Material, colour, wall shape and thickness can change how a pan behaves. The arithmetic does not account for these features. King Arthur Baking’s pan-size guidance discusses why changing the vessel can change the bake even when the ingredient amounts seem to fit.
Oven space matters as well. Check that the pan fits without preventing the clearances required by the appliance instructions. When splitting a recipe across several pans, consider the number that can be baked as directed. Do not assume every oven performs identically when filled with multiple trays.
Make a note that you can repeat.
Record the original recipe, both pans, the multiplier used and any ingredient rounding. Keep the recipe’s stated doneness checks and any required food-safety measurements in view. A timing change should be observed and documented rather than produced by multiplying the old time.
If the recipe is unusually sensitive or the new pan is radically different, finding a recipe for the pan you own may be the easier route. The calculator is most useful when it reveals the scale of a change before you commit to it.
